Loading
Salesforce から送信されるメールは、承認済ドメインからのみとなります続きを読む

ISPICKVAL() 関数が特定の選択リスト値に対して機能しません

公開日: Oct 13, 2022
説明
数式項目、ワークフロールール、プロセス、入力規則などで使用する数式を作成し、1 つを除くすべての値で機能しています。

例:

次の値が含まれる、「Fruit」カスタム選択リスト項目があります: 「Apple」、「Banana」、「Cherry」、「Durian」...

対応する選択リストの値が選択されると、それぞれ A、B、C、D を返す数式項目を作成しています。「Apple」、「Banana」、「Durian」を含むすべての値で数式が問題なく機能していますが、「Cherry」でだけ機能しません。
解決策

数式で使用している選択リスト項目に移動し、機能しなかった選択リスト値を見つけます。選択リスト値用にリストされている [API 参照名] が [値] 列に表示されているものとまったく同じかどうかを確認します。まったく同じではない場合は、代わりに数式で ISPICKVAL() 関数に API 参照名を使用します。これで正常に機能するはずです。

ISPICKVAL() 関数では、実際の値そのものではなく値の API 参照名が使用されます。通常、これらの値は同じですが、選択リスト値の名前が変更されると、新しい選択リスト値の名前に合わせて手動で変更しない限り、API 参照名は変更されません。

関連情報:数式を作成する際のヒント
ナレッジ記事番号

000380973

 
読み込み中
Salesforce Help | Article